Melissa De Sousa
Melissa De Sousa (born September 25, 1967 in New York City ) is an American actress .
Life
The ancestors of the actress come from Panama . De Sousa made his debut on an episode of the 1992 television program CBS Schoolbreak Special . Guest appearances in television series and a major role in the drama Spark (1996) followed. She also played a bigger role in the comedy Abgefahren (1998).
The role in the comedy The Best Man (1999) with Taye Diggs , Nia Long and Morris Chestnut earned De Sousa a nomination for an Image Award in 2000 . She played Miss New York in the comedy Miss Undercover (2000) with Sandra Bullock in the lead role . In 2003 she was nominated for the Black Reel Award for her role in the comedy 30 Years to Life (2001) . In the film drama Constellation (2005) she played one of the bigger roles alongside Rae Dawn Chong .
